Belmont Abbey College Completes Historic “Cover to Cover” Bible Marathon Reading Event

Belmont, N.C. (April 17, 2024) – Belmont Abbey College recently concluded a groundbreaking initiative known as “Cover to Cover,” a marathon reading of the Bible. From Monday, April 8th, through Thursday, April 11th, the college community embarked on a continuous reading of the Bible, marking a significant milestone in the institution’s history. This unique endeavor, possibly the first of its kind among Catholic colleges in the United States, aimed to unite the Belmont Abbey community through a profound immersion in the Bible and served as preparation for the Bishop’s Youth Pilgrimage event for the Diocese of Charlotte operated by the college’s Hintemeyer Scholarship Program students and held on the Abbey’s campus. The Cover to Cover event, which took place outside the college’s main administration building, Stowe Hall, saw participants standing at a podium, reading aloud from Sacred Scripture throughout the day and night. Students, faculty, monks, and staff took turns reading, ensuring a seamless transition from one reader to the next. Wesley Nelson, Director of Campus Ministry, marveled at how many people had echoed his own feelings: that “the particular passage that the Lord had ordained that I would be reading was of particular meaning to me in my relationship with Him.” Lily Miller, a freshman at Belmont Abbey College, shed tears as she read from John’s Gospel, particularly touched by the poignant exchange between Christ and Peter.

Involving over 110 readers, the Cover to Cover event was completed in 85 hours and 42 minutes and concluded in the early hours of Friday, April 12th, a precursor of grace for the upcoming Bishop’s Youth Pilgrimage. During a final gathering, Tom MacAlester, the Vice Provost and Dean of Student Affairs, quoted the last chapter of Revelation, emphasizing the eternal nature of the participants’ faith journey.

Dr. MacAlester reflected on the significance of the event, stating, “Our first Cover to Cover event at Belmont Abbey College began with the transit of the moon between us and the sun: a partial solar eclipse. In a tangible and celestial way, God was communicating to our little community that by embarking on this unique and beautiful journey we were, in a way, living these words. By proclaiming the word of God continuously, we found we did not need a ‘lamp or sun’ to illuminate our path. We had Scripture to provide that to us. And God Himself, revealed through the entirety of the Bible, shone that light straight down Abbey Lane.”

This immersive experience aligns with the Benedictine prayer tradition, which emphasizes the continuous engagement with the Word of God. The Cover to Cover event serves as a testament to the enduring monastic tradition of 1,500 years, carrying forward the practice of faithful and contemplative scripture engagement.

Belmont Abbey College Announces the Fr. Joseph Koterski Endowed Scholarship

Belmont, N.C. (April 8, 2024) – On the 2024 celebration of the Feast of the Annunciation, Belmont Abbey College announces the establishment of the Fr. Joseph Koterski Endowed Scholarship. This scholarship, dedicated to the legacy of former Belmont Abbey Board of Trustee member, Fr. Joseph Koterski, and generously established by Noel J. and Maggi Fitzpatrick Nadol, will provide valuable financial support to Belmont Abbey students pursuing a degree in Nursing.

Fr. Joseph W. Koterski, SJ, lived out a vocation of servant leadership, witnessing to the profound love of God as priest, teacher, and pro-life advocate. His love for God overflowed with love for everyone especially the unborn. He would often have those around him reflect on “the heart of Christ beating in the womb of Mary.” Fr. Koterski spent almost 30 years as an associate professor at Fordham University. During that time, he also served in a variety of roles, from Philosophy Chair and Director of the Master of Arts in Philosophical Resources to Chaplain and Master of the residential college at Queen’s Court. Fr. Koterski’s commitment to the pro-life movement and his unwavering love for God made him an influential figure at Belmont Abbey College.

The scholarship aims to help nursing students graduate with a lesser financial burden, enabling them to pursue their vocations of service to the community with greater freedom. In dedicating this endowed scholarship to the memory of Fr. Koterski, Noel J. and Maggi Fitzpatrick Nadol hope to reward and inspire in Belmont Abbey nursing students the same servant leadership and joyful dedication to the cause of life.

Belmont Abbey College is actively restoring the growth and development of the healthcare industry through the formation of ethical, holistic, and compassionate nursing professionals. As these students graduate and enter the workforce, they will bring with them the values of servant leadership and a deep commitment to the well-being of others, positively influencing the communities they serve.

Belmont Abbey College Adds Cybersecurity, Computer Science, and Digital Marketing – Three New Online & Hybrid Undergraduate Programs

Belmont, N.C. (April 3, 2024) – Belmont Abbey College announces the addition of three new online and hybrid academic programs. Focused on the digital and computer sciences, the new degrees provide students with expertise in high-demand areas where employers search for talent. The college introduces Bachelor’s Degrees in Cybersecurity, Computer Science, and Digital Marketing.

Through a strategic collaboration with Rize Education, Belmont Abbey College has expanded its program offerings to include cutting-edge online courses that prepare students for successful careers. Available in both hybrid (combining on-campus and online courses) and fully online formats, these programs provide students with a dynamic and flexible educational experience. This collaboration offers numerous benefits, including a flexible schedule, access to industry experts nationwide, and the opportunity to acquire resume-ready skills. Combined with the Abbey’s core in the liberal arts, these degrees promise a well-rounded experience that will equip students for the workforce. 

The BS in Computer Science degree offers a dynamic learning experience tailored to suit students’ diverse interests in computing. The curriculum empowers students to analyze problems using expertise in computer technology, critical thinking abilities, research proficiency, and adeptness in articulating solutions across different audiences. Project-based and portfolio-building classes will help graduates produce impressive resumes before graduation and hone skills that hiring managers demand. Potential careers with this credential include work as a Computer Programmer, Database Analyst, or Software Developer.

The BA in Cybersecurity at Belmont Abbey College prepares students with technical expertise and business acumen, positioning them for lucrative and in-demand roles in this rapidly expanding field. Dedicated to cultivating ethical leaders committed to innovation, this program aims to redefine excellence in cybersecurity education. Through inventive curriculum, hands-on experience, and a focus on ethical decision-making, this program empowers students to adapt to and mitigate emerging digital threats, safeguarding organizations and communities in an increasingly interconnected world. Graduates with a degree in Cybersecurity can join the professional world as Forensic Examiners, IT Auditors, and Security Analysts.

The BA in Digital Marketing degree, available as an online major or in-person minor, helps students develop as nimble thinkers, skilled in both the art of persuasive communication and the science of data analytics. Belmont Abbey’s program gives students a deep background in both, along with the intuition needed to blend them into an effective strategy. The program begins with core business fundamentals rooted in Catholic values and then teaches digital marketing concepts critical for today’s emerging marketers. Individuals with a BA in Digital Marketing can work in several capacities, including Advertising, E-commerce, Market Research, and Technology. 

Dr. David Williams, Vice Provost for Academic Affairs and Dean of Faculty at Belmont Abbey College, expressed his excitement about the new academic offerings, stating, “We are thrilled to expand our program offerings to meet the evolving needs of our students and the demands of the job market. Rooted in the principles of Catholic and Benedictine education, these new academic programs will not only equip our students with the skills and knowledge necessary to excel in high-demand fields but also instill in them a sense of responsibility to contribute positively to the world around them.”

These new programs are available starting this fall through a partnership with the Lower Cost Models Consortium (LCMC) and Rize Education. The LCMC is a strategic partnership of private colleges and universities nationwide, collaborating with Rize Education to provide access to a cutting-edge curriculum that prepares students for successful careers.

According to Kevin Harrington, CEO of Rize, “We are proud to collaborate with Belmont Abbey College in delivering high-quality online courses that prepare students for success in the most in-demand fields. Our partnership will give students the tools they need to thrive in the rapidly evolving job market.”

Belmont Abbey College remains committed to providing its students with a well-rounded, liberal arts education that prepares them for future success. By expanding its academic offerings to include Computer Science, Cybersecurity, and Digital Marketing, the college is ensuring that its graduates are equipped with the skills and knowledge needed to excel and ethically lead in today’s workforce.

About the Lower Cost Models Consortium (LCMC): The LCMC is a national consortium of over 130 fully accredited, non-profit colleges and universities formed in 2015. Members of the LCMC are committed to working together to address the challenges of increasing costs in higher education by implementing innovative programs and reducing institutional costs for these programs to pass along savings to students. In this way, the LCMC hopes to develop new models of higher education that benefit students while simultaneously contributing to the sustainability of accredited, nonprofit, 4-year institutions.
